Lawrence, MA (January 20, 2025) – Emergency responders were dispatched to the scene of a motor vehicle crash with reported injuries at 77 S Union St on Saturday evening. The incident occurred at approximately 8:08 p.m., prompting a response from Engine 9 and other emergency personnel.
Upon arrival, first responders assessed the scene and provided medical care to the injured individuals. Due to the severity of the injuries, a second ambulance was requested to ensure all victims received prompt transportation to nearby hospitals for further evaluation and treatment. The number of individuals injured and the extent of their injuries have not yet been disclosed.
Local authorities are investigating the circumstances leading to the crash, with factors such as road conditions and potential driver error under review. Traffic disruptions were reported in the area as emergency crews worked to clear the scene and assist those involved.
